‘TV bias’ decision
PA Wellington The Broadcasting Corporation yesterday made a decision on the Prime Minister's complaint of bias in last year's election coverage, but would not sav what it was.
After a board meeting, the chairman (Mr lan Cross) said that Mr Muldoon would be told of the decision before any public announcement.
He said that two other Complaints were discussed al
yesterday's meeting, but they were "minor" matters, and not connected with broadcasting coverage of the Springbok lour, as had been reported.
The board had also discussed the position of the "Listener" and its copyright use of advance programme information. It would probably make a statement on this today, he said
